Everyone who is proud in heart is an abomination to the Lord; Assuredly, he will not be unpunished. Proverbs 16:4-5 MAN HARDENS… 1. When we think we have power of our own. But the magicians of Egypt did the same with their secret arts; and Pharaoh’s heart was hardened, and he did not listen to them, as the Lord had said. Exodus 7:22 2. When we ask God’s help… then when relief comes, we don’t do what we promised. But when Pharaoh saw that the rain and the hail and the thunder had ceased, he sinned again and hardened his heart, he and his servants. Exodus 9:34 3. When we see God’s power and we turn a deaf ear. “But, indeed, for this cause I have allowed you to remain, in order to show you My power, and in order to proclaim My name through all the earth. “Still you exalt yourself against My people by not letting them go. Exodus 9:16-17 4. When we have opportunity to do good and we don’t do it. “If there is a poor man with you, one of your brothers, in any of your towns in your land which the Lord your God is giving you, you shall not harden your heart, nor close your hand from your poor brother; Deuteronomy 15:7 5. When we have opportunity to believe and we refuse to do it. And Jesus, aware of this, *said to them, “Why do you discuss the fact that you have no bread? Do you not yet see or understand? Do you have a hardened heart? Mark 8:17 6. By the deceitfulness of sin. But encourage one another day after day, as long as it is still called “Today,” lest any one of you be hardened by the deceitfulness of sin. Hebrews 3:13 7. When we are confronted with truth, and we turn away. But when some were becoming hardened and disobedient, speaking evil of the Way before the multitude, he withdrew from them and took away the disciples, reasoning daily in the school of Tyrannus. Acts 19:9 HARDENING: Taken Away Through Jesus Christ But their minds were hardened; for until this very day at the reading of the old covenant the same veil remains unlifted, because it is removed in Christ. 2 Corinthians 3:14 How blessed is the man who fears always, But he who hardens his heart will fall into calamity.
